What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
Frequently Asked Questions about Duluth
How much are Studio apartments in Duluth?
There are currently 11 Studio Apartments in Duluth with rent ranges from $1,103 to $2,371 with an average price of $1,522.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Duluth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Duluth ranges from $878 to $5,577 with an average monthly rent of $1,688.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Duluth c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Duluth range from $1,052 to $8,361.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,054.
How expensive are Duluth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 58 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Duluth on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,431 to $8,557 - averaging $2,431 for the location.
